// TableWrite describes a table root that should be written to the index contract.
type TableWrite struct {
FirstBlock uint64
TableSize uint64
Root common.Hash
}

// BuildLogIndexForBlock builds the EIP-8304 level-0 log index table for the given
// block. Interim implementation: fixed-size entries and a flat keccak root
func BuildLogIndexForBlock(blockNumber uint64, receipts types.Receipts) []TableWrite {
b0 := types.NewIndexBuilder()
b0.AddBlockEntries(blockNumber, receipts)
return []TableWrite{{FirstBlock: blockNumber, TableSize: 1, Root: b0.Build()}}
}

// setCalldata builds the 96-byte set payload: first_block, table_size,
// table_root (all big-endian 32-byte words).
func setCalldata(firstBlock, tableSize uint64, root common.Hash) []byte {
calldata := make([]byte, 96)
binary.BigEndian.PutUint64(calldata[24:32], firstBlock)
binary.BigEndian.PutUint64(calldata[56:64], tableSize)
copy(calldata[64:96], root[:])
return calldata
}

// getCalldata builds the 64-byte get payload: first_block, table_size.
func getCalldata(firstBlock, tableSize uint64) []byte {
calldata := make([]byte, 64)
binary.BigEndian.PutUint64(calldata[24:32], firstBlock)
binary.BigEndian.PutUint64(calldata[56:64], tableSize)
return calldata
}

// indexSlot is the storage slot for a table root per the EIP-8304 spec:
// table_size * TABLES_PER_LEVEL + (first_block / table_size) % TABLES_PER_LEVEL.
func indexSlot(firstBlock, tableSize uint64) common.Hash {
return common.BigToHash(new(big.Int).SetUint64(tableSize*0x400 + (firstBlock/tableSize)%0x400))
}

// ProcessLogIndexWrites performs the EIP-8304 system call to write a table root
// to the on-chain index contract. It follows the same pattern as processRequestsSystemCall
// (EIP-7685) to ensure state changes persist correctly.
func ProcessLogIndexWrites(tw TableWrite, rules params.Rules, evm *vm.EVM, blockAccessIndex uint32, blockAccessList *bal.ConstructionBlockAccessList) error {
if tracer := evm.Config.Tracer; tracer != nil {
onSystemCallStart(tracer, evm.GetVMContext())
if tracer.OnSystemCallEnd != nil {
defer tracer.OnSystemCallEnd()
}
}
gasLimit, gasBudget := systemCallGasBudget(evm)
// Build 96-byte calldata: first_block(32) + table_size(32) + table_root(32)
calldata := make([]byte, 96)
binary.BigEndian.PutUint64(calldata[24:32], tw.FirstBlock)
binary.BigEndian.PutUint64(calldata[56:64], tw.TableSize)
copy(calldata[64:96], tw.Root[:])
msg := &Message{
From: params.SystemAddress,
GasLimit: gasLimit,
GasPrice: uint256.NewInt(0),
GasFeeCap: uint256.NewInt(0),
GasTipCap: uint256.NewInt(0),
To: &params.IndexContractAddress,
Data: calldata,
}
evm.SetTxContext(NewEVMTxContext(msg))
evm.StateDB.Prepare(rules, common.Address{}, common.Address{}, nil, nil, nil)
evm.StateDB.SetTxContext(common.Hash{}, 0, blockAccessIndex)
evm.StateDB.AddAddressToAccessList(params.IndexContractAddress)
_, _, err := evm.Call(msg.From, *msg.To, msg.Data, gasBudget, common.U2560)
if evm.StateDB.AccessEvents() != nil {
evm.StateDB.AccessEvents().Merge(evm.AccessEvents)
}
bal := evm.StateDB.Finalise(evm.GetRules())
if err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("EIP-8304 system call failed: %v", err)
}
blockAccessList.Merge(bal)
return nil
}
